The bathroom remodeling market in Haxtun is characteristic of a small, rural community. There is limited competition *within* the city limits, leading most residents to seek services from contractors based in Sterling (approx. 20 miles away), which acts as the regional commercial center. The quality of available contractors is generally high, with many family-owned businesses boasting long track records and strong local reputations. Due to the rural location and the need for contractors to travel, project pricing can be slightly higher than in urban areas to account for travel time and logistics. Homeowners should expect a competitive but not oversaturated market, where securing a reputable provider requires planning and potentially longer lead times, especially during peak construction seasons. A basic bathroom refresh (new vanity, fixtures, paint) might start in the $5,000-$10,000 range, while a full-gut remodel with layout changes and high-end materials can easily exceed $20,000.

In Haxtun, a full bathroom remodel typically ranges from $15,000 to $35,000+, depending on the scope and material choices. Local factors that can increase costs include the need to transport materials and subcontractors from larger cities like Sterling or Denver, and the potential for discovering outdated plumbing in older homes common to the area. Investing in quality, water-efficient fixtures can offer long-term savings on our region's water usage.
Haxtun's high-plains climate with cold winters and dry conditions requires careful planning. We recommend scheduling major demolition and plumbing work for late spring through early fall to avoid frozen ground complications for any septic or water line work. For material choices, we advise using products rated for low humidity to prevent warping and selecting flooring with good thermal properties for comfort during cold snaps.
Yes, most structural, plumbing, and electrical work will require permits from the Town of Haxtun or Phillips County Building Department. This is crucial for ensuring work meets Colorado state building codes, which include specific requirements for ventilation, GFCI outlets in bathrooms, and water conservation standards. A reputable local contractor will handle this permitting process for you.
Prioritize contractors with verifiable local references and physical presence in Northeast Colorado. Given our rural location, confirm they have reliable subcontractor networks for specialized trades like plumbing and electrical. Check for proper Colorado licensing and insurance, and ask how they handle material procurement delays, which are common given our distance from major suppliers.
In Haxtun's older homes, we frequently discover galvanized steel plumbing pipes that may need full replacement, inadequate or non-existent bathroom ventilation leading to moisture damage, and subflooring in need of repair. Additionally, the region's expansive clay soil can sometimes cause minor foundation shifts that may need addressing before installing new rigid tile or fixtures. A thorough inspection during the quote phase is essential.
